Commercial Gutter Maintenance in Denver County, CO
Commercial gutter maintenance services involve inspecting, cleaning, and repairing the gutter systems on commercial properties to ensure proper water flow and prevent damage. This service covers a variety of projects, including clearing debris from gutters and downspouts, checking for leaks or blockages, fixing sagging or damaged sections, and ensuring that gutter systems are securely attached and functioning effectively. Property owners typically want to understand the scope of the maintenance, the importance of regular upkeep to prevent water damage, and any specific preparations needed before service.
Before requesting commercial gutter maintenance, property owners should consider the size and complexity of their gutter system, as well as any recent weather conditions that may have caused debris buildup or damage. It’s also helpful to know if there are any access issues or specific areas that require special attention. Understanding these details can help ensure the maintenance process is efficient and thorough, helping to protect the building’s foundation, roof, and landscaping from potential water-related issues.

Common Commercial Gutter Maintenance Jobs
Gutter cleaning - removing debris to prevent blockages and water damage.
Gutter inspection - identifying issues like leaks, rust, or sagging gutters.
Gutter repairs - fixing leaks, loose brackets, or damaged sections for proper function.
Downspout maintenance - clearing clogs and ensuring proper water flow away from the foundation.
Gutter sealing - applying sealants to prevent leaks and extend gutter lifespan.
Gutter installation - replacing or upgrading existing gutters for improved performance.
Commercial Gutter Maintenance Questions
What is commercial gutter maintenance? It involves cleaning, inspecting, and repairing gutters on commercial properties to ensure proper water flow and prevent damage.
Why is regular gutter maintenance important for commercial buildings? Regular maintenance helps prevent water damage, foundation issues, and structural deterioration caused by clogged or damaged gutters.
What types of gutter issues are commonly addressed? Common issues include debris buildup, leaks, sagging gutters, and damaged or loose components needing repair or replacement.
How often should commercial gutters be maintained? Gutter maintenance is typically recommended at least twice a year, especially after seasons with heavy rain or storms.
